What is the cheapest month to fly from Oslo Gardermoen Airport to Miami?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ights from Oslo Gardermoen Airport to Miami,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.
The cheapest month for flights from Oslo Gardermoen Airport to Miami is September, where tickets cost £333 on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and July, where the average cost of tickets is £548 and £535 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Oslo Gardermoen Airport to Miami?

To calculate daily average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each day before departure over the last year for flights from Oslo Gardermoen Airport to Miami,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each month.
To get a below average price on the flight from Oslo Gardermoen Airport to Miami, you should book around 1 week before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 80 days before departure.

Which airlines fly direct between Oslo Gardermoen Airport and Miami?

Airline and price data is aggregated from results in KAYAK’s search results from the last 2 weeks for flights from Oslo Gardermoen Airport to Miami.
There is just one airline that flies from Oslo Gardermoen Airport to Miami direct and that is Norse Atlantic Airways. The best one-way deal found from Norse Atlantic Airways for the route is £230.

How many flights are there between Oslo Gardermoen Airport and Miami per day?

There is a maximum of 1 direct flight a day that takes off from Oslo Gardermoen Airport and lands in Miami, with an average flight time of 10h 10m. The most common departure time is 11:00 and most flights take off in the morning. Each week, there are 2 flights.

How long does a flight from Oslo to Miami take?

Direct flights take on average 10h 10m to travel the 4,728 miles between Oslo and Miami.

Norse Atlantic is the worst airline I’ve ever traveled with, and i travel a lot. First, they made me check my carry on duffle (never had a problem before) because my backpack they said “isn’t a personal item”. It fits under the seat so yes it is a personal item. $125€ for the duffle and $125€ for my wife’s checked bag, $250€ for two bags, RIPOFF! Once on the flight we got delayed 45mins because the attendants/airline were giving a handicap gentleman a hard time about his scooter which they had already given him permission to bring on board. He also stated he’s never had this problem, & after a lengthy discussion they finally realized they were wrong since it wasn’t ion battery operated and he had all the paperwork. Eventually they allowed him to stow it above his seat which they watched his wife struggle with for over a minute before they helped her. Also, Make sure you purchase food in advance! This airline is EVERYTHING for purchase, from WATER to SNACKS to BLANKETS. Yes, WATER. International flight and not a single thing free. People were literally lining up to the bathroom with empty water bottles to fill up in the sink. The Aircraft was criminally FREEZING as if they intentionally jacked up the air so people would buy $7€ blankets. People were changing into layers in the bathroom & bringing down their carry-ons so they could find layers in their suitcases. Those that didn’t have layers in their bag or had to check their bags had to endure an 8.5hr torture session from Rome to JFK. Add all that to the ridiculous timing of turning on the lights (red eye) so they could come down the aisle with duty “free” options for purchase. A hot topic between passengers while waiting to deboard/get through customs. I wouldn’t fly Norse Atlantic Airways again if they paid me.
